Edging is the practice of developing tidy, specified borders in between different landscape aspects, such as lawns, garden beds, pathways, and patio areas. Proper edging enhances the visual appeal of a property, avoids lawn from trespassing into flower beds, and makes maintenance jobs like cutting much easier and more precise. Techniques consist of installing physical barriers like metal, plastic, or stone edging, along with shaping soil or turf to develop natural borders. Material option and installation methods vary depending on the wanted visual, landscape design, and long-term toughness. Routine upkeep of edges avoids overgrowth, keeps crisp lines, and contributes to a sleek, deliberate appearance. Efficient edging is both a useful tool and a style aspect, improving the general organization and beauty of a landscape
